* Fix to able to recover from GraphicsModeException in the override OnHandleCreated.

* Changes according to comments:
- m_implementation and m_context is now always set. To DummyGLControl if CreateContext fails
- Changed FailedCreateContext -> HasValidContext
- Changed all if{} to short style with braces.
- Added null propagation when applicable
- Renamed member variables to have 'm_' infront.
- and more ...

* Changed 'm_' prefix into '_'
Added braces to be using Allman Style

* Fixed:

  2) SA1003: GLControl.cs(226,47): Operator '(IGraphicsContextInternal)' must not be followed by whitespace.
  3) SA1003: GLControl.cs(412,49): Operator '(float)' must not be followed by whitespace.

* Removed Paket.Restore.targets from sourcecontrol
Added *.Restore.targets to .gitignore

* Fixed comments
Added *.DotSettings to .gitignore

* Removed *.DotSettings from GitIgnore
Moved *.Restore.targets to Paket section
